  • Ahmia.fi: A search engine that indexes valid .onion sites. It is transparent and maintained by security researchers.
  • Tor Metrics: Not a link list, but tells you which hidden services are most popular based on traffic.
  • Dark.fail: A real-time uptime checker for major dark web sites. It is the gold standard for verification.
